1. What is Money Illusion?
Money illusion is the cognitive bias that causes people to focus on the nominal value of money—how much they have in terms of actual currency—rather than its real value, adjusted for inflation. This concept was first introduced by the economist Irving Fisher in the early 20th century. Fisher argued that individuals often make economic decisions based on the nominal value of money, overlooking the effects of inflation, which leads them to make flawed judgments about their financial well-being.
For instance, if wages increase by 5% while inflation rises by 4%, a person might feel that they are better off, even though the increase in wages only slightly outpaces inflation, resulting in a real wage increase of just 1%. The person might still perceive this nominal wage increase as a substantial improvement, neglecting the fact that their purchasing power has only marginally improved.
2. The Role of Inflation in Money Illusion
Inflation plays a critical role in money illusion. When inflation is high, people are less likely to adjust their expectations to account for the erosion of purchasing power. This can lead to an overestimation of the benefits of nominal wage increases, salary raises, or returns on investments. The challenge arises because people tend to think of money as a fixed quantity, without considering the fluctuations in its real value over time.
Let me illustrate this with a simple example: suppose a worker receives a 10% raise in nominal wages, but inflation is 8%. In nominal terms, the worker has gained more money, but in real terms, the raise is only 2%. This discrepancy can create a false sense of improvement in financial circumstances.
The formula to calculate the real wage increase is as follows:
Real\ Wage\ Increase = \frac{(1 + Nominal\ Wage\ Increase)}{(1 + Inflation\ Rate)} - 1For this example:
Real\ Wage\ Increase = \frac{(1 + 0.10)}{(1 + 0.08)} - 1 = 0.0185 \text{ or } 1.85%While the nominal wage increase is 10%, the real wage increase is only 1.85%. However, if the worker is not accounting for inflation, they may feel that their financial situation has improved significantly.
3. Behavioral Economics and Money Illusion
Money illusion ties closely with behavioral economics, which studies how psychological factors influence economic decision-making. Individuals do not always act rationally, especially when it comes to understanding and responding to economic signals. When people experience money illusion, they may misinterpret nominal increases as real gains, even when the increase in real purchasing power is minimal or nonexistent.
This irrational behavior often manifests in situations such as wage negotiations, investment decisions, and consumer spending. For example, a person may feel happier about receiving a 5% raise in a year with high inflation, as opposed to a 5% raise in a year with no inflation, even though the real income has remained the same in both cases.
One critical concept within behavioral economics is “mental accounting,” where individuals treat money differently based on its source or intended use. For instance, a person might view a tax refund or a bonus as extra money, while failing to adjust for inflation or the overall financial picture. This mindset exacerbates money illusion, as it encourages people to view money in isolation rather than as part of a broader economic environment.
4. The Economic Implications of Money Illusion
Money illusion can have significant macroeconomic effects, especially when inflation expectations are not properly managed. This can lead to several undesirable outcomes:
4.1 Wage-Price Spiral
In an environment where money illusion prevails, workers and employers may engage in a wage-price spiral. This occurs when workers demand higher wages to compensate for what they perceive as a decrease in their purchasing power due to inflation. In turn, employers may raise prices to cover the increased wage costs, perpetuating the cycle of rising wages and prices.
The problem with this cycle is that it can lead to excessive inflation, eroding the real value of wages and savings. If individuals fail to recognize that their nominal wage increase is not keeping pace with inflation, they may continue to demand higher wages, further driving inflation.
4.2 Inefficient Consumption and Investment Decisions
People who fall victim to money illusion may make suboptimal decisions in both consumption and investment. For example, consumers might overestimate their purchasing power and increase spending, only to realize later that their ability to buy goods and services has not improved as much as they thought. Similarly, investors may make investment decisions based on nominal returns, ignoring the impact of inflation on their real returns.
For instance, consider a scenario where a person invests $10,000 in a bond yielding 5% annually. After one year, they receive $500 in interest. However, if inflation is 4%, the real return on their investment is only 1% (since the nominal return of 5% is partially offset by inflation). If this person does not account for inflation, they may believe they have made a profitable investment, even though the real value of their return is quite small.
The formula for calculating real returns, considering inflation, is:
Real\ Return = \frac{1 + Nominal\ Return}{1 + Inflation\ Rate} - 1For this example:

5. Mathematical Models and Money Illusion
To better understand the relationship between nominal and real economic variables, economists often turn to mathematical models. One such model is the Quantity Theory of Money, which relates the money supply, price level, and output in an economy. According to this theory, an increase in the money supply leads to a proportional increase in the price level, assuming constant output.
The Quantity Theory of Money can be expressed using the equation:
M \cdot V = P \cdot QWhere:
- MM is the money supply,
- VV is the velocity of money (how often money is spent),
- PP is the price level,
- QQ is the output or real GDP.
If the money supply increases, and assuming the velocity of money and output remain constant, the price level (PP) will rise, leading to inflation. In a scenario with money illusion, individuals might perceive an increase in nominal wealth due to the higher money supply, without realizing that the real value of their wealth has not increased, due to rising prices.

6. Mitigating Money Illusion: The Role of Education and Policy
One of the ways to mitigate the effects of money illusion is through public education about inflation and real purchasing power. By understanding how inflation erodes the value of money, individuals can make more informed decisions about wages, consumption, and investment.
Additionally, governments and central banks can implement policies to increase the transparency of inflation expectations and improve communication about monetary policy actions. When people are more aware of how inflation affects the real value of money, they are less likely to fall victim to money illusion.
